KUKA KR AGILUS achieves automation in food processing

The Dutch family-owned brand, Vepo Cheese, sought a solution for automating food processing: Two KUKA KR AGILUS sanitary robots are tasked with processing cheese into strips and feeding them into the packaging machine. This automated process not only enhances hygiene conditions but also doubles production capacity.
Product Case Benefits
1.Increased Production Capacity:
Innovative technology boosts production capacity from 5,000 to 10,000 units per hour.

2.Automated Cutting and Packaging Technology:
The LAMBDA 405 cutter precisely slices cheese into individually packaged snack strips.
Simple operation reduces human contact, ensuring the highest hygiene standards.

3.Automated Detection and Precision Operation:
Cameras scan cheese slice positions, allowing the KR AGILUS HM to accurately pick and cut, ensuring even slices.
Checkweighers measure each cheese strip's weight, minimizing weight variance.

4.Smart Food Processing:
Fully automated production line with robots operating throughout, significantly reducing cutting waste and increasing productivity.
KUKA.Sim simulation software and VR glasses allow customers to preview the complete system.

5.Compliance with Top Food Hygiene Standards:
Corrosion-resistant surfaces, food-grade lubricants, and stainless steel parts ensure product safety.
Compliant with national and international food hygiene regulations.
